Abstract We have carried out at Fermilab the first search for the lepton-family number violating decay K L → π 0 μ ± e ∓ . There were no events observed. By normalizing to K L → π + π − π 0 decays collected simultaneously, the 90% confidence level upper limit on 1 2 [ BR (K L →π 0 μ + e − )+ BR (K L →π 0 μ − e + )] was determined to be 3.1×10 −9 .

Abstract The energy-dependence of the K 0 - K 0 parameters Δ m , τ S and η +− suggested by Fermilab regeneration data is analyzed phenomenologically. Such variations with energy can arise from the interaction of the kaons with an external field or medium, and several specific examples are studied in detail.
